Centrales |  Componentes |  consola |  Debug |  Default |  Fuentes |  SalidaGrafica |  Seguridad |  SIUToba |  Varios |  Deprecated

toba_extractor_clases

toba_extractor_clases

Ubicada en php/lib/toba_extractor_clases.php [line 9]



Métodos Propios
void   __construct ()  
void   es_clase_repetida ()  
void   generar ()  
void   generar_archivo ()  
void   generar_arreglo ()  
void   generar_vacio ()  
array   get_clases_repetidas ()  
array   get_pms_no_encontrados ()  
void   init_registro ()  
void   mostrar_clases_repetidas ()  
void   obtener_archivos ()  
void   preparar_excluidos ()  
void   registrar_clase ()  
void   set_extends_excluidos ()  

__construct   [línea 33]

  __construct( $puntos_montaje )

Parámetros:
   $puntos_montaje: 





es_clase_repetida   [línea 212]

  es_clase_repetida( $montaje , $clase )

Parámetros:
   $montaje: 
   $clase: 





generar   [línea 70]

  generar( )






generar_archivo   [línea 186]

  generar_archivo( $path , $contenido , $punto_montaje )

Parámetros:
   $path: 
   $contenido: 
   $punto_montaje: 





generar_arreglo   [línea 125]

  generar_arreglo( $path_montaje , $archivos , [ $extras = array() ] )

Parámetros:
   $path_montaje: 
   $archivos: 
   $extras: 





generar_vacio   [línea 90]

  generar_vacio( )






get_clases_repetidas   [línea 56]

  array get_clases_repetidas( )

Devuelve un arreglo ordenado por punto de montaje que contiene las clases repetidas que se encontraron para cada pm





get_pms_no_encontrados   [línea 46]

  array get_pms_no_encontrados( )

Devuelve un arreglo de los puntos de montaje que no fueron encontrados mientras se construía el archivo de autoload





init_registro   [línea 166]

  init_registro( )






mostrar_clases_repetidas   [línea 198]

  mostrar_clases_repetidas( )






obtener_archivos   [línea 103]

  obtener_archivos( $path , [ $excluidos = array() ] )

Parámetros:
   $path: 
   $excluidos: 





preparar_excluidos   [línea 112]

  preparar_excluidos( $path , $excluidos )

Parámetros:
   $path: 
   $excluidos: 





registrar_clase   [línea 174]

  registrar_clase( $montaje , $clase , $path )

Parámetros:
   $montaje: 
   $clase: 
   $path: 





set_extends_excluidos   [línea 65]

  set_extends_excluidos( array $extends )

Setea los nombres de las clases de las cuales si extienden no van en el autoload
Parámetros:
array   $extends: 






Desarrollado por SIU.
Documentación generada con phpDocumentor